Pandas DataFrame squeeze() 方法

实例

将 DataFrame 压缩成 Series:

  1. import pandas as pd
  2. data = {
  3. "age": [50, 40, 30, 40, 20, 10, 30]
  4. }
  5. df = pd.DataFrame(data)
  6. s = df.squeeze()
  7. print(s)

定义与用法

squeeze() 方法将单列 DataFrame 转换为 Series。


语法

  1. dataframe.squeeze(axis)

参数

这些参数是 关键字参数

参数描述
axisNone
0
1
'index'
'columns'
可选。 默认值 None。 指定需要压缩的轴

返回值

一个 Series , 或一个 DataFrame 如果不是单列 DataFrame。

分类导航